King Abdullah meets Israeli PM Netanyahu in surprise Jordan visit, says royal court
Israeli PM Benjamin Netanyahu met King Abdullah of Jordan, where the latter said Israel must respect the status quo for the Al-Aqsa mosque. — Reuters pic

AMMAN, Jan 24 —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u today held talks in Jordan with King Abdullah, who stressed the need for Israel to respect the status quo of the Al Aqsa mosque compound in Jerusalem, known to Jews as the Temple Mount, a royal court statement said. — Reuters
